What's your display size and resolution? If the UI looks too small, you might try reducing the display resolution or increasing Windows Scaling. I believe you can adjust this latter setting per program through Program Properties>Compatibility>Change High DPI option.

FWIW, I have my 17-inch laptop set to 1920 x 1080 with Windows Scaling set to 100%, even though the laptop display is capable of considerably higher. At this setting, Moho's UI size is ideal for me. (As is the UI for most other programs I run on this laptop.)

Try undocking and closing the Keyframe window. That will free up more space for the timeline so you might not need to zoom out as far. I keep the Keyframe window closed most of the time, and really only open it when I'm setting a Cycle key (in which case, the window opens automatically. When I'm done, I close it again to reduce screen clutter.)

FWIW, I don't think I've ever had to show over 500 frames at once...at that size, yeah, the keys are pretty small and not easily selectable. Normally, I view about 100-200 frames in the timeline, which keeps the key size reasonably selectable and editable. Also, instead of zooming, I just pan the timeline using RMB...much better than zooming, IMO.

Customization is always good but in this case I think that, as Greenlaw pointed out, it's more about zoom than anything else. Because I think there is no space available to make the keyframes bigger when you are trying to display 300 frames at the same time. They only look like they could be bigger in your image because you don't have a keyframe on each frame, so they are spaced out.
